摘要: 报道了CuSO4(ZnSO4)-CO(NH2)2-H2O两个三元体系在30℃时的等温溶度及饱和溶液的折光率,绘制了相应的溶度图和折光率-组成图.两个三元体系中分别形成了组成为CuSO4·3CO(NH2)2·H2O(异成分溶解)和ZnSO4·CO(NH2)·2H2O(同成分溶解)的化合物,并通过元素分析、红外光谱、X射线粉末衍射及热分析对新相进行了表征.

Abstract: CuSO4-CO(NH2)2-H2Oand ZnSO4-CO(NH2)2-H2O ternary systems have been in-vestigated by isothermal method at 30 ℃. Their solubility diagrams and refractive index-composition diagrams have been constructed. New ternary compounds formed in each system respectively, CuSO4·3CO(NH2)2·H2Oincongruently dissolved in the former system and ZnSO4·CO(NH2)2·2H2O congruently dissolved in the latter and new compounds were confirmed by IR, TG and X-ray diffraction methods.
